Rose Kathryn (Yates) Wilson, 93, went home to be with her Lord and Savior, Jesus, on Wednesday, March 25, 2026.

Kathryn was born in 1933 in Dickson, Tennessee, to Leonard and Oles Yates. Her life was marked by resilience, dedication, and an enduring love for family.

She held a variety of jobs throughout her life, most notably serving with the New York State Department of Taxation and Finance until her retirement. Kathryn later joined FEMA, where she found deep fulfillment in helping individuals and families rebuild after disasters—her compassion and desire to serve others evident in all she did.

In the 1990s, Kathryn returned to college, demonstrating her determination and lifelong commitment to personal growth. In 2001, she and her beloved husband, Robert “Bob” Wilson, fulfilled a lifelong dream by traveling to Hawaii, enjoying six weeks of rest, beauty, and cherished memories together.

Kathryn was an active member of the Women of Grace Bible Study for seven years and served alongside Pastor Jay Richmond at First Baptist Church of Scotia, blessing many lives in her community. She delighted in hosting large family gatherings, especially during the holidays, filling her home with laughter, warmth, and love.

She was predeceased by her parents; her husband, Robert Wilson; her sisters, Bessie Potts, Emma Yates, Lula Ferris, and Martha Shore; her brother, John D. Allen; her children, Diane Armstrong, Bonnie Wilson, Barbara Goodwin, Wesley Breaux, and Daniel Wilson; her daughter-in-law, Jill Wilson; her son-in-law, Thomas Balsamo; her grandsons, Shane Haney and Alex Ducos; and her great-grandson, Ethan Vile.

Kathryn is survived by her loving children: Dianna Balsamo of Clifton Park, New York; Deborah (Len) Smith of Glastonbury, Connecticut; and Cheryl (Luis) Ducos of Woodruff, South Carolina. She also cherished her extended and adoptive family: Robert Wilson II of Amsterdam, New York; George Wilson (Patricia) of Saratoga Springs, New York; Joseph Wilson (Joan) of Greenwich, New York; Kathleen Smith (Ray) of Schenectady, New York; and Andrew Wilson of Fort Hunter, New York.

She is also survived by her sister, Margaret Baron of Enfield, Connecticut, along with many cherished grandchildren, great-grandchildren, nephews, and nieces.

Kathryn will be remembered for her strength, sense of humor, generosity, and unwavering devotion to her family. Her legacy lives on in the countless lives she touched.

Calling hours will be held at Bond Funeral Home, Broadway & Guilderland Avenue, Schenectady, NY, on Thursday, April 2, from 10:00 to 11:30 a.m. A Celebration of Life service will follow at 11:30 a.m. Entombment will be in the mausoleum at Schenectady Memorial Park.
